Specifications
DC Resistance (DCR): 2 Ohm Max
Height - Seated (Max): 0.065" (1.65mm)
Size / Dimension: 0.100" L x 0.100" W (2.54mm x 2.54mm)
Supplier Device Package: --
Package / Case: Nonstandard, 2 Lead
Mounting Type: Free Hanging (In-Line)
Inductance Frequency - Test: 7.9MHz
Operating Temperature: -55°C ~ 105°C
Ratings: --
Frequency - Self Resonant: 70MHz
Q @ Freq: 35 @ 7.9MHz
Series: 100
Shielding: Unshielded
Current - Saturation: --
Current Rating: 89mA
Tolerance: ±1%
Inductance: 2.7µH
Material - Core: Iron
Type: --
Part Status: Active
Packaging: Bulk
